Sorcetti

Pastina

Ingredients Flour, potatoes, spinach, and eggs. Sometimes corn flour is mixed with the wheat flour.

How Made The potatoes are boiled and riced while still warm. The spinach is boiled separately, then squeezed and finely chopped. Cold potatoes and spinach are kneaded with sifted flour and eggs. It is not necessary to leave the dough to rest. Small pieces of dough are pinched off and rolled between the hands to make little logs about β…œ inch (1 cm) in diameter. These are cut on the bias into lengths of about ΒΎ inch (2 cm), which are boiled briefly in salted water and drained as soon as they float.
